ECAT CS — Computer Fundamentals scoring & marking scheme

+4
Per correct answer
-1
Per wrong answer
0
Per blank / skipped
0–60
Scaled score range

Strategy: ECAT CS — Computer Fundamentals penalises wrong answers (-1 per mistake). Skip a question if you cannot eliminate at least 2 options — guessing blindly hurts your scaled score more than blanking.

ECAT CS — Computer Fundamentals (15 Q) · Computer — MS Excel
Q1. In MS Excel, a formula always begins with the sign:
Why: Correct answer: D — =. Topic: Computer — MS Excel.
ECAT CS — Computer Fundamentals (15 Q) · Computer — MS PowerPoint
Q2. MS PowerPoint is used mainly to create:
Why: Correct answer: A — presentations (slides). Topic: Computer — MS PowerPoint.
ECAT CS — Computer Fundamentals (15 Q) · Computer — MS PowerPoint
Q3. In MS PowerPoint, the shortcut key to start a slideshow from the beginning is:
Why: Correct answer: B — F5. Topic: Computer — MS PowerPoint.
ECAT CS — Computer Fundamentals (15 Q) · Computer — Internet
Q4. "WWW" stands for:
Why: Correct answer: C — World Wide Web. Topic: Computer — Internet.
ECAT CS — Computer Fundamentals (15 Q) · Computer — Internet
Q5. A "URL" is the:
Why: Correct answer: D — address of a web page. Topic: Computer — Internet.
ECAT CS — Computer Fundamentals (15 Q) · Computer — Internet
Q6. Which of the following is a web browser?
Why: Correct answer: A — Google Chrome. Topic: Computer — Internet.
